Although Washington D.C. legalized cannabis for both medical and adult-use in 2015, the laws can be a bit complicated. While cultivation and possession were legalized, selling marijuana for recreational use in DC was unfortunately not. That being said, it is legal to gift marijuana and some have taken advantage of this workaround. Otherwise, there are several medical marijuana dispensaries that can be used to purchase cannabis with a valid MMJ card. Given its proximity to DC, it should also be noted that Virginia recently legalized adult-use cannabis. While anyone over 21 may possess up to one ounce of cannabis and grow up to four plants, dispensaries won't be open in the state until 2024.
